Output 320830de4cb3f4031a729ca07e362130579376238c45e296fd9c5bfa75091a64:0

value
976486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c99a05cb770bbb6a4e2a854d3b71178f537e3648 OP_EQUAL
address
MSH8ZfiwWj6CaqdrVi7QhSZuXxYyPVQDVd
transaction
320830de4cb3f4031a729ca07e362130579376238c45e296fd9c5bfa75091a64
spent
true